This course presents this training course in (Tourism Business Management), in view of the significant role provided by the Tourism Sector all over the world. Tourism activities are like any other professional types of activity, it could be endangered due to various types of risks and tourist crises that may affect tourism activities on individual levels, or by nature of tourism in the country, especially since tourism is highly sensitive and highly influenced by external risk factors. Therefore such risks and crises shall be fully handled directly and strictly by the Hotel & Tourism Management, through diligent quest to satisfy needs, wants, and desires of clients (tourists), while achieving the required financial surplus at the meantime. This Training Program provides a roadmap for dealing with such crises, which is very helpful for trainees.
